Step 2. Start cutting from the bottom, not the top. Michael Natiello, pumpkin carving pro and creative director for The Great Jack-o’-Lantern Blaze, says cutting your “lid” from the bottom of the pumpkin helps prevent the sides from caving in later.
Do you need to cut a hole in the top of a pumpkin?
Top – It’s standard practice to cut the hole in the top. If you do, angle your knife at 45 degrees when you make the cut. This solves the problem of the top falling inside the pumpkin when you put the “lid” on.
How do you carve a pumpkin easy?
How to carve the perfect pumpkin…
- Choose a large pumpkin and use a sharp serrated knife to cut off the crown.
- Using a large serving spoon, scoop out the seeds and fibres and discard.
- With a marker pen, draw a simple outline of a face on the pumpkin.
- Pop a tea light inside the pumpkin, light it and replace the crown.

How do you prepare a pumpkin?
To Boil: Halve the pumpkin; remove seeds, pulp, and stringy portion. Cut into small pieces and peel. Cover with lightly salted water and boil for about 25 minutes, or until tender. Mash, purée in a blender or food processor or put through a food mill.
Do you leave the top on a pumpkin when lit?
As opposed to carving the top portion of the pumpkin to create a removable lid, experts suggest cutting out the bottom instead. It’s much easier to place the pumpkin with a hole in the base over top of a lit candle than putting the candle inside the pumpkin from the top where there’s a greater risk of receiving a burn.

What do you do with pumpkin seeds after carving?
If you carve pumpkins but don’t want to roast the seeds right away, rinse them to remove the pulp and refrigerate in an airtight container. Roast within 2 to 3 days. You can also freeze raw pumpkin seeds—just wash them to remove the pulp, then allow them to dry completely before freezing in an airtight container.
Where do you cut a hole in a pumpkin?
Step 1: Cut a Hole in the Pumpkin
If using a candle for illumination, you can cut the hole in the pumpkin’s top (always put the candle in a high-sided glass, and never leave it unattended). If using electric lights, cut the hole in the bottom or side so you can hide the cord.

How do you make pumpkins shine?
Use Vaseline and a clean cloth to buff your pumpkins and make them bright + shiny! The Vaseline will also act as a sealer for the pumpkins. Be sure to wash and dry them well before doing this step! You can also use Vaseline on the exposed cut edges of a carved pumpkin to help those last longer too!

What is the best knife for cutting squash?
Start with a large, sturdy knife.
Leave your small knives where they are. When it comes to cutting up a large, firm winter squash, the best tool for the job is a large (think: eight inches or larger), relatively heavy and sharp chef’s knife.
